BidsFactory is a global procurement intelligence platform that aggregates public tender opportunities from official sources worldwide into a single searchable database. Built and maintained by Aninver Development Partners, an international consulting firm specialising in development cooperation,...

SeqOps is a cybersecurity firm offering advanced security solutions such as vulnerability scanning, penetration testing, cloud and server security, and compliance analysis. We help businesses safeguard digital infrastructure with tailored, automated, and proactive protection services.
